Jim Corner, the owner of Corner Bike Rentals, wants to start analyzing his company's quality. For each bike rental, there are 4 types of customer complaints: (1) bike not working properly, (2) wrong bike size, (3) bike uncomfortable, and (4) bike broken during operation. During the past week, his company rented 380 bikes. He received a total of 22 complaints.
? What is his company's DPMO for the past week?
? What is its Six Sigma operating level?
